2 The MARC record search by OCLC number brought up the correct record the most directly with only one record as a result for both of the two searches. Four matches resulted in a search by ISBN number for The Coffee Trader. When searching for The Coffee Trader through a title search, the search had six record matches. A search for the record by author (Liss, David) resulted in even more possible records, 462. While a 30 Days of Night search by ISBN number resulted in seven records. Then, a title search matched 186 records covering five different formats. A search by author (Lebbon, Tim) resulted in 169 possible records. The results show that OCLC record number followed by ISBN number, then title, and finally author are the most to least direct search options. In completing a direct search, it is best to search for terms that have the least amount of data possible. Each MARC record only has one OCLC record number, that number is specific to one record, which is why it is the best criteria to search for. There were multiple records for both titles when each record was searched author and title. The multiple records were a result of different forms of the text. The easiest way to determine which was the record I was actually searching for was by the OCLC record number. I matched that number to the assignment to be sure to have the correct two records. However, if the OCLC record number was unknown, there are other ways to narrow the results. The search hits can be displayed in two ways: a truncated screen and a brief view screen. The brief view screen is more helpful because it provides more detailed information about each record. You can match the information that is known about the book (edition, language, etc.) to the information in the brief view screen. Another way to find the best record is to look at the number of records created for each holding and pick the most numerous to get a good record. 1

3 MARC Record: 30 Days of Night OCLC Record # Days of Night MARC Record Analysis 008 Fixed fields: Rec Stat c Definition: The record status. c means the record was corrected or revised. Entered Definition: Entered is the date the record was input into WorldCat means year: 2007, month: November, day: 1. November 1, Replaced Definition: Replaced represents the date of the last replace transaction means: year 2012; month: January; day: 23; hour: 10; minute: 37; second: 39; fraction of a second: 9 is when the record was last replaced. Type: a Definition: The type of record. Use to differentiate records created for various types of machine-readable information and specific types of material. a means language material. BLvl: m Definition: Bibliographic Level. The relationship between the item being cataloged and its constituent parts. m means Monographic component. Desc: a Definition: Descriptive Cataloging Form. The form of descriptive cataloging; that is, whether the item has been cataloged according to the provisions of International Standard Bibliographic Description. a means the descriptive part of the record is formulated according to AACR2 cataloging rules. ELvl: blank Definition: The degree of completeness of the machine-readable (MARC) record. blank means Full Level: most complete MARC record. Form: blank Definition: The form of material being described. blank means none of the following codes are appropriate. Cont: blank 2

4 Definition: Nature of contents, the item contains certain types of material. blank means not specified. BKS, CNR. The nature of the contents of an item is not specified. Ills: blank Definition: Illustration terms used in the physical description. blank means no illustrations. Srce: blank Definition: Cataloging Source, which is used to indicate the original cataloging source of the record. blank means National Bibliographic Agency, indicates the original creator of the original cataloging data is a national bibliographic agency. Conf: 0 Definition: Conference Publication, whether the item consists of the proceedings, report, or summaries of a conference. 0 means Not a conference publication. Gpub: blank Definition: Government Publication, whether the item is a government publication and establishes the jurisdiction level of the issuing body. blank means Not a government publication. Fest: 0 Defintion: Festschrift, whether or not work is a festschrift 0 means Not a festschrift. Audn: blank Definition: Target audience, the intellectual level of the audience in which the item was intended. blank means Unknown or unspecified. Biog: blank Definition: Biography, whether or not the item is biographical. blank means No biographical material. LitF: 1 DtSt: s Definition: Literary Form, whether or not the item is a work of fiction. 1 means Fiction, The item is a work of fiction and no further identification of the literary form is desired. Definition: type of date/publication status. s means single date, single items or multipart items complete in one year. 3

5 Ctrl: blank Definition: Type of control, archival control status. blank means No specific type of control. MRec: blank Definition: Modified Record, whether bibliographic information was modified for entry into machine-readable form. blank means Not modified. Indx: 0 Definition: Index, Whether the work has an index, location index or gazetteer to its own contents. 0 means No Index. Dates: 2007 Definition: Dates represents two MARC fields: Date 1 and Date 2. Each date has four digits, separated by a comma. Use Date 1 for the beginning date of publication (chronological designation) and Date 2 for the ending date is Date 1 (beginning date of publication, Date 2 is blank (unknown or unlisted). Lang: eng Definition: Language code eng means English. Ctry: nyu. Definition: Country of Publication, etc. nyu means New York State.
